A key focus of the laboratory is the development and optimization of processes related to biogas, biofuels, and hydrogen. We investigate purification routes for biogas upgrading, enabling the production of high-quality biomethane, as well as separation technologies essential for biofuel refinement. In the context of hydrogen, we explore advanced purification and separation techniques that support clean energy applications and the transition toward low-carbon energy systems.
Our research encompasses both fundamental and applied approaches, including adsorption and absorption processes, liquid-liquid extraction, and hybrid systems. By combining experimental work with modeling and simulation, we aim to enhance process performance while minimizing energy consumption and environmental impact.
